Hi Junli ,

 

Attached GSO5 : Additives Permitted for Use In Food Stuffs is applied for all GCC ,

 

E 153:vegetable carbon is permitted in page 151 as per the page footer under title "Annex Table )1A) Permitted Natural Colours for Use in Foodstuffs in General"

 

for E555 I could not locate it in the document  , you can find Calcium aluminium silicate ,Aluminium silicate ,

As per post 2, "by omission",  E555 is apparently not yet authorised for use (see para 1.1).

 

Note that E554 is approved [assuming "INS" has the same meaning as "E" ( I was unable to find the verification of this in the document)]
